WATERSIDERS' UNION
EXEMPTION FROM DISPUTE
QUEENSLAND APPLICATION.
(United Press Association.—Copyright.)(Received 3rd December, 11.30 a.m.) BRISBANE, This Day.
An application by the employers of waterside labour in Queensland for the de-registration of the Watersiders' Union and the cancellation of its award,' consequent upon tho "no overtime" strike, came before the Board of Trade and was adjourned to allow the union to make representations to the Federal Executive for tho exemption of Queensland from the dispute.
